On Thanksgiving morning, MTA talmidim woke up for a day off from yeshivah. However, it was certainly not a day off from serious learning. MTA rebbeim gave shiurim on Thanksgiving morning in many of the communities in which talmidim reside. From West Hempstead to Monsey, Brooklyn to Bergenfield, and several more, MTA talmidim and parents were able to enjoy a morning of Torah and t’filah together to start off their day off on the right foot.
